I obviously wouldn't tail anyone in tennis - other than EaglesPhan if I want action and haven't had a chance to look myself (and he should be on this list imo) - but in other sports I've tailed a ton of guys. I always post when I do and give them credit win or lose. In fact it was tailing lakerboy back in 2010 that finally convinced me to sign up for SBR after lurking for a year so I could tell him thank you. Guy not only made me money but his thread and the people in kept me sane and my spirits up when my kid was in the hospital all that time. I think a lot of us forget, including myself often, how many people look at our posts even if they never post in our thread. Having a list like this that isn't full of guys just touting themselves but genuinely pointing out others who may be able to help is a good thing I think.Comment -
